Hi all...Karmacat...what I meant was I forgot that there was a balance on that Virgin card and it had just come out of it's 0% period.I was offered another 0% on that card and took it forgetting about the balance that was already on it gaining interest.
What usuaully happens is that the payments will come of the lowest interest balance first...leaving the one behind gathering interest a big mistake!!!0 -
